WickedWillie and I had a very romantic dinner date tonight although I was a tad disappointed he did not bring flowers. We went to PJ's, which is right next to La Roca across from the little Playero. On Wednesday and Friday they currently have a 2 for 1 special from 6 - 8 PM. We both had the half BBQ chicken with salad and fries. The chicken was very good and moist; served with a side of BBQ sauce. I think WickedWillie inhaled his. He had a beer and I had a coke. Total bill was 450 pesos.

I will be back.

Those nights are also Karaoke night so make certain you get out of there before the gringas start singing ABBA songs around 8:30 PM.
